Factors that confer resistance to apoptosis in lung myofibroblasts/fibroblasts

MoleculeBasic mechanismMediatorsRef.
IL-6Reduces FasL induction of apoptosisSTAT-3, Bcl-2[11]
TGF-β1Blocks IL-1β inductioniNOS, Bcl-2[12]
ThrombinBlocks FasL inductionPAR1, protein kinase C-ϵ, p21[18]
IGF-1Blocks induction by growth factor withdrawalAkt, ERK phosphorylation[19]
FIZZ-1#Blocks TNF-α inductionERK1/-2 phosphorylation[20]
Anti-α2β1 integrinLigation of integrinPhosphatidylinositol 3-kinase, Akt[17]
  • IL: interleukin; TGF: transforming growth factor; IGF: insulin-like growth factor; Akt: protein kinase B; FasL: Fas ligand; STAT: signal transducer and activator of transcription; iNOS: inducibile nitric oxide synthase; PAR: proteinase-activated receptor; FIZZ: found in inflammatory zone; TNF: tumour necrosis factor; ERK: extracellular signal-related kinase. #: e.g. resistin-like molecule-α.
